Cherry Pie Filling
This Cherry Pie Filling recipe is easy to make with just three ingredients for a delicious homemade pie filling.
Prep Time 25 minutes mins
Cook Time 15 minutes mins
Total Time 40 minutes mins
Course Dessert
Cuisine American
Servings 6 cups
Calories 219 kcal
- 4 cups pitted tart red cherries
- 1 cup white sugar
- ¼ cup cornstarch
Gather the ingredients.
Place cherries into a saucepan over medium heat. Cover and cook, stirring often, until cherries release their juices and come to a simmer, 10 to 15 minutes.
Whisk sugar with cornstarch in a bowl until combined; pour mixture into hot cherries and juice. Stir until thoroughly combined.
Bring to a simmer over low heat; cook until thickened, about 2 minutes. Remove from heat and let cool before using as pie filling.
